On Tuesday, September 16, the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) announced that Apollo Tyres is the new lead sponsor of the Indian cricket team for a whopping winning bid of INR 579 Crore. Notably, Team India, led by Suryakumar Yadav, doesn’t have any front-jersey sponsor during the ongoing Asia Cup 2025 campaign.
It’s important to note that Apollo Tyres will give a whopping INR 4.77 Crore per match to the Indian cricket team. According to a report published on Cricbuzz, the base price set by the BCCI was INR 3.5 crore for bilateral games and INR 1.5 crore for the World Cup matches.
While the sponsorship deal spans two-and-a-half years and covers 121 bilateral games and 21 ICC matches, the agreement concludes in March 2028. Under the terms of the deal, the Apollo Tyres logo will be featured on the jerseys of the Indian men's and women's national teams across all formats.
"The arrival of Apollo Tyres as our new sponsor is a testament to the hard work and consistent performance of our teams. We are excited about this being Apollo's first major sponsorship in India cricket, which speaks volumes about the sport's unparalleled reach and influence. This is more than a commercial agreement; it's a partnership between two institutions that have earned the trust and respect of millions,” Devajit Saikia, BCCI Honorary Secretary, said.
"We are delighted to welcome Apollo Tyres as our new lead Sponsor. This is a momentous occasion, bringing together two of India's most powerful and enduring legacies: the unwavering spirit of Indian cricket and the pioneering legacy of Apollo Tyres. The competitive nature of the bidding process highlights the strong market confidence in the BCCI and the global brand of Team India. We are confident that this partnership will be a driving force for mutual growth and success,” Rajeev Shukla, Vice-President, BCCI, said.
“This partnership is a testament to the immense value and global appeal of Indian cricket. Apollo Tyres’ commitment to innovation and its forward-thinking approach perfectly aligns with our vision for the future of the game. We are confident that this collaboration will be a huge success and will help us continue to grow the sport both in India and around the world,” Prabhtej Singh Bhatia, Treasurer, BCCI, said.
